		<title>Genetic Disorders for Which Prenatal Diagnosis Is Available</title>
		<link>http://guideonhavingbaby.com/genetic-disorders-for-which-prenatal-diagnosis-is-available.html</link>
		<comments>http://guideonhavingbaby.com/genetic-disorders-for-which-prenatal-diagnosis-is-available.html#comments</comments>
		<pubDate>Tue, 01 Apr 2008 15:37:20 +0000</pubDate>
		<dc:creator>admin</dc:creator>
		
		<category><![CDATA[Planning for a Healthy Pregnancy]]></category>

		<guid isPermaLink="false">http://guideonhavingbaby.com/genetic-disorders-for-which-prenatal-diagnosis-is-available.html</guid>
		<description><![CDATA[¦ Tay-Sachs — a disease that causes fatal brain damage — is more common in people of Central and Eastern European Ashkenazi Jewish descent and in certain French-Canadian subpopulations. It occurs in about 1 in 3,600 infants born to members of these ethnic groups.
